Stop Trying to Be Uberman
The "Uberman" polyphasic schedule was a viral trend that ruined many people's health. The human brain requires sustained cycles to clear amyloid plaque (waste products).
Enter: Sleep Density
Sleep Density = (Time Asleep / Time in Bed) × 100
Most efficient sleepers have a density of 90%+. Insomniacs are often below 70%. The goal isn't to sleep less, it's to waste less time lying awake or in light, junk sleep.
